Superstition Real Estate & Property Management (SREPM) is seeking a Designated Broker to provide compliance oversight and supervisory support for a growing property management company. This is not a day-to-day operational role . The company currently manages 160+ residential units , with established systems, staff, and processes in place. The Designated Broker will serve in a high-level oversight capacity , ensuring compliance with Arizona Department of Real Estate (ADRE) regulations and supporting risk management.
ARIZONA BROKERS LICENSE REQUIRED.
Key Responsibilities Provide Designated Broker supervision in accordance with ADRE requirements Oversee and review trust accounting practices Conduct periodic file and compliance audits Ensure adherence to Arizona real estate laws and regulations Review and advise on company policies, procedures, and risk exposure Be available for escalated compliance or legal concerns Provide guidance on best practices for property management operations
